The canned drink has the carbon dioxide already trapped inside of it, while the fountain drinks have the carbon dioxide poured inside of it WHILE it is pouring out of the fountain and into the cup. For carbonated drinks at least.....
Products with the highest profit margins include prescription drugs, diamonds, fountain drinks, and designer clothing. Fountain drinks cost businesses a few cents, but cost consumers $1 to $2 on average.

Jane Pittman is a character from the novel "The Autobiography of Miss Jane Pittman" by Ernest J. Gaines. In the novel, Miss Jane drinks from the fountain as a symbolic act of defiance against racial segregation and oppression. It represents her courage and determination to resist the injustices she faces as an African American woman living in the South.
